DARKER HARDWOOD FLOORS
Many of our home owners chose darker hardwood floors in 2019. With softer greys, taupes and whites being the most popular choices in wall and cabinetry colors, a darker floor contrasts well. NATURAL HARDWOOD FLOORS
In 2019, the trends continued to vere towards more natural selections. Soft colors and materials that are found in nature, have always been a great, classic choice for home finishes, and that "trend" is certainly here to stay.
